Most vintage Fred Bear bows have "some" value, the collectors market for older recurves is growing fairly steady IMHO. I would suspect you would get something out of it on EBay.

That said, it looks like the front face was drilled for the sight, which probably doesn't help. It looks like the riser is showing some dings in the finish around the grip area. It's not mint, but it's probably a shooter, and that has some interest to a buyer that might actually use it.

It wouldn't cost you much to run an auction for a week and see what the interest is. I would estimate it would sell between $50 to $100 as is, but that is a rookie opinion, not an expert.
